Dhanush’s manager Shreyas confirms fake casting call scam; Manya Anand clarifies she never accused the actor’s team

TV actress Manya Anand clarified she was contacted by an impersonator claiming to be Dhanush’s manager, not his actual team. Dhanush’s manager, Shreyas, issued a statement confirming all casting calls in his name are fake and a police complaint has been filed. The public is urged to verify official numbers as no active casting is underway.

The controversy surrounding fake ‘casting calls’ made using Dhanush’s manager’s name has once again become a major talking point, with new clarifications emerging. A few days ago, TV actress Manya Anand stated in an interview that a person claiming to be Dhanush’s manager, Shreyas, had asked her for ‘adjustments’ in exchange for a film opportunity. The comment triggered a massive stir on social media. Since only a clipped portion of her interview went viral, many assumed the remarks were direct allegations against Dhanush and his manager.

Manya Anand clarifies she never blamed Dhanush’s team

Manya Anand soon issued a social media clarification, stating, “I am not blaming anyone. The person who contacted me may have been an impersonator. I have no intention of accusing Dhanush or his manager. If you watch my full interview, you will understand the truth. Some people have deliberately edited and circulated parts of the video.”

Manager Shreyas issues official statement confirming all casting calls in his name are fake

Amid rising speculations, Dhanush’s manager Shreyas released an official statement addressing the issue. “As early as January 2024 and February 2025, I publicly announced that all casting calls released under my name and in the name of Dhanush’s company Wunderbar are fake. The numbers and individuals currently going viral have no connection to me or our company. They have misused my photograph,” he stated.

Police complaint filed; public urged to verify official numbers

Shreyas further confirmed that a police complaint had already been filed. He urged the public to remain alert to prevent further scams and to verify official numbers before responding to any suspicious casting-related messages. He also clarified that there is currently no active casting or selection process being conducted for Dhanush.
